This post is over 30 days old. The position may no longer be available

Senior Software Engineer (Big Data)

dataxu , Bangalore · dataxu.com · Full-time employment · Programming

dataxu’s vision is to make marketing better using data science. The world’s top brands and agencies partner with DataXu to better understand and engage their customers across all available media formats, devices, channels, and buying modes.  Our advertising solution, ranked #1 in the industry by Forrester Research in 2015, provides marketers with unparalleled Media Activation, Marketing Analytics and Data Management capabilities.

https://www.dataxu.com/programmatic-marketing/

https://www.youtube.com/watch?v=5lBeQxdSEAs

dataxu seeks a highly motivated Big Data Developer for the Streaming Analytics Squad to participate in the engineering of  dataxu ’s automated media decision platform for marketers. This position is based out of our Bengaluru (India) office. If you know what it takes to work with 100s of Terabytes worth of data, this is the job for you!!!

On the Job

  • Develop, test, debug, support and enhance software as per product specifications.
  • Work with a highly skilled engineering team in all phases of the product development lifecycle.
  • Work with quality assurance, release engineering and product management to deliver quality software.
  • Actively participate in reviews - code, design and architecture.
  • Mentor and drive collaboration in a geographically distributed team and function.
  • Willingness to learn new technologies is a must.

About You

  • 5+ years of software development experience.
  • Proven understanding of how to build complex, distributed, multi-threaded fault tolerant, self-healing systems.
  • Ability to understand a large complex legacy system and able to make adjustments without breaking existing functionality (while its running as well).
  • Expert knowledge of Java 8 (or more) and hands-on experience with Map Reduce family of technologies.
  • Good understanding of Algorithms, Data structures and performance optimization techniques.
  • Familiarity with UNIX environments.
  • Strong sense of ownership and collaboration skills.
  • Excellent verbal and written communication skills.
  • Attention to detail with focus on quality.

Bonus Points

  • Experience working with production deployments in AWS.
  • Experience with test automation and containers.
  • Experience with agile design and release methodologies.
  • Good knowledge of Spark, Scala.

Life at dataxu is truly unique. From Day 1, through an industry leading employee integration program, we work hard to ensure that our new XuKeepers (dataxu – get it?) understand our values and what behaviors contribute to a successful career here at dataxu.

Here’s what we are all about:

Free weekly lunches, happy hours and costume competitions? Yeah, we’ve got all that. We’re totally obsessed with our customers, our product, our people and innovation—all of which tie right in with our corporate values. We Collaborate across all teams and global offices. Our customers Trust us because we put transparency and their needs first. Innovation is part of everything that we do. Excellence is our standard mode of operation. And of course, Customer Obsession. We wouldn’t be here without our customers! So, interested in working here yet? Visit DataXu.com to learn more!

Individuals seeking employment at dataxu are considered without regards to race, color, religion, national origin, age, sex, marital status, ancestry, physical or mental disability, veteran status, gender identity, or sexual orientation.

Apply for this position

Login with Google or GitHub to see instructions on how to apply. Your identity will not be revealed to the employer.

It is NOT OK for recruiters, HR consultants, and other intermediaries to contact this employer